1. Energy Efficiency In today’s world, where energy conservation is paramount, using weather stripping door seal tape can make a noticeable difference in your heating and cooling costs. By effectively sealing the gaps around doors, it helps prevent warm air from escaping during winter and keeps cool air inside during summer. This can lead to significant savings on energy bills while also reducing your carbon footprint.

One of the primary functions of a door seal bottom is to improve energy efficiency. During extreme weather conditions—whether sweltering heat or frigid cold—gaps at the bottom of doors can lead to significant heat loss in winter and heat gain in summer. Even small gaps can create drafts, forcing heating and cooling systems to work harder to maintain comfortable indoor temperatures. This not only impacts comfort but also increases energy bills. By installing a high-quality door seal, homeowners can reduce energy consumption, lower utility bills, and contribute to environmental sustainability.

The primary advantage of non-slip shower flooring is safety. Wet surfaces, especially in the shower, can become hazardous and increase the risk of slips and falls, which can lead to serious injuries. According to the Centers for Disease Control and Prevention (CDC), falls are a leading cause of injury among older adults, and wet surfaces are a significant factor. Non-slip flooring features textures and materials designed to provide better traction, significantly reducing the likelihood of accidents.

Glycerin also plays a role as a sweetener and flavor enhancer. With about 60% of the sweetness of sucrose, glycerin can be used to promote a sweet flavor profile without significant calories, making it an attractive option for low-calorie and sugar-free products. This quality is particularly appealing to manufacturers aiming to develop health-conscious alternatives, such as diabetic-friendly foods and beverages. Moreover, its ability to dissolve and blend flavors makes glycerin a valuable ingredient in sauces, dressings, and beverages, helping to deliver a balanced and appealing taste.

Acesulfame K, commonly referred to as Acesulfame Potassium, is an artificial sweetener that can be found in a wide array of products, including soft drinks, desserts, and sugar-free foods. It is known for its intense sweetness, approximately 200 times sweeter than sucrose (table sugar), but it contains no calories. Acesulfame K is often used in combination with other sweeteners to enhance sweetness and mask any aftertaste associated with other artificial sweeteners.

One of the primary benefits of biochar as a fertilizer is its capacity to improve soil fertility. Biochar can significantly increase the soil's cation exchange capacity (CEC), which is the ability of soil to hold and exchange positively charged ions, including essential nutrients such as calcium, magnesium, and potassium. This means that biochar-infused soils can retain nutrients more effectively, reducing the need for synthetic fertilizers, thereby lowering costs for farmers and minimizing environmental impact.
Nutritive additives are compounds that contribute directly to the nutritional profile of food products. They can be naturally derived or chemically synthesized and are often added to boost essential nutrients like vitamins, minerals, proteins, or fats. Common examples of nutritive additives include vitamins such as vitamin D and B12, minerals like calcium and iron, and proteins such as whey and casein. These additives not only fortify existing foods but can also help address specific nutritional deficiencies within populations.
The predominant application of urea-formaldehyde resin is in the wood-based composites industry. The production of particleboard and MDF relies heavily on UF resin as it not only binds the wood fibers together but also enhances the density and durability of the final product. Additionally, UF resin is commonly used in the manufacturing of laminates, which find their utility in both residential and commercial environments.

One of the primary applications of glacial acetic acid is in the production of acetylated derivatives. It is a key precursor for acetate esters, which are widely used as solvents in paints, inks, and coatings due to their excellent solvency and evaporation properties. In addition, glacial acetic acid is used in textile and plastic formulations, acting as both a solvent and a chemical intermediate.

2. Disinfectants To ensure microbial safety, disinfectants such as chlorine, chloramine, and ozone are commonly used. Chlorine is one of the most widely used disinfectants due to its effectiveness against a broad spectrum of pathogens. However, it is crucial to monitor chlorine levels to avoid the formation of potentially harmful byproducts known as trihalomethanes (THMs). Ozone, a powerful oxidizing agent, is used for its effectiveness in inactivating viruses and bacteria without leaving harmful residues.
